[Debian-med-packaging] Bug#962550: libgclib breaks gffread autopkgtest: Segmentation fault
Adrian Bunk
bunk at debian.org
Sun Jul 5 18:09:47 BST 2020
Control: reassign -1 libgclib1 0.11.9-1
Control: retitle -1 libgclib1: ABI break without soname change
Control: affects -1 src:libgclib src:gffread
On Tue, Jun 09, 2020 at 09:25:27PM +0200, Paul Gevers wrote:
>...
> line 109: 8435 Segmentation fault gffread ${gff} > /dev/null
>...
#0 0x000055555556e8a8 in GHash<GPVec<GffObj> >::DefaultFreeProc (
item=0xffffffff00000000) at /usr/include/gclib/GHash.hh:60
#1 0x00007ffff7f4276f in GHash<GPVec<GffObj> >::Clear (this=<optimized out>)
at GHash.hh:575
#2 GffReader::readAll (this=0x555555590a40) at gff.cpp:1828
#3 0x000055555556a9d6 in GffLoader::load (this=0x55555557b180 <gffloader>,
seqdata=...,
gf_validate=0x55555555a83c <validateGffRec(GffObj*, GList<GffObj>*)>,
gf_parsecomment=0x55555555a56a <processGffComment(char const*, GfList*)>)
at gff_utils.cpp:695
#4 0x000055555555c620 in main (argc=2, argv=0x7fffffffe698)
at gffread.cpp:1271
The root cause is that libgclib changed ABI without changing soname.
cu
Adrian
More information about the Debian-med-packaging
mailing list